Episode 38 Store Windows and Old Underwear
00:24:48 | December 19th, 2019

L. Frank Baum, an author of a classic book (which became a classic movie) was also partially responsible for our love of fancy holiday shop windows. Also, Meriwether Lewis gives his pal William Clark a re-gift he probably could’ve done without.
